Abstract

The invention discloses a method for realizing the control application of an intelligent television controller, which comprises the following steps: step S10, identifying the current use scene of the intelligent television; step S20, monitoring the keys of the user controller; and step S30, performing normal operation on the application. The method comprises the steps of firstly monitoring key contents of a page of the top-level application, identifying a use scene of the current application, identifying the type of a key when a user operates the controller key, and comprehensively analyzing the scene and the key, so that corresponding operation can be realized for the user.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of intelligent televisions, in particular to a method for realizing control application of an intelligent television controller.
Background
With the popularization of intelligent televisions with various sizes and types, people's requirements for the televisions are no longer limited to watching broadcast television signals, but are connected with the internet to enjoy more and more wonderful functions, and a series of applications such as games, videos, education, life services, entertainment and the like can be used on the televisions. Then there must be involved control of the application.
At present, the practice of the widespread smart television is to operate the applications on the television using the up/down/left/right/ok/return/home keys of the remote controller, and most of the applications on the market are also developed based on these operation keys. However, the market is so large that different user groups always exist, so different types of smart televisions need to be developed to meet the requirements of different users. Some television manufacturers have introduced special smart televisions, such as small televisions and antique televisions, for this part of the population. These televisions, because of their location, provide different operational controls to enable control of the application. These different controllers may have fewer keys than a common remote controller, and if existing smart television applications are installed, the situation that some functions cannot be controlled occurs, and in general, secondary development is performed on the existing smart television to solve the problem. However, this method is time-consuming and labor-consuming, and greatly limits the richness of this type of tv application.

Detailed Description
Emb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Example 1
As shown in fig. 1, in the present embodiment, a knob is used to replace a remote controller as a control mode for a user to control an application; firstly, a knob controller needs to be used on the intelligent television equipment to replace a traditional television remote controller. The control mode that the knob can satisfy has: and rotating and clicking.
The rotary control mode of the knob: the knob supports clockwise rotation and anticlockwise rotation; clockwise rotation is similar to the remote control right key, and counterclockwise rotation is the remote control left key. Click manipulation manner of knob: the knob is pressed loose, similar to the OK key of a remote control.
The implementation method for the application operation specifically comprises the following steps:
to implement the operation of an application generally requires the first step of identifying which application is currently used by the user and specifically to which scenario of the application. After knowing the specific scene, the user's key is monitored, and the purpose of the user is determined by combining the key with the scene. And finally, realizing corresponding operation according to the purpose of the user. Through the above steps, it is found that several problems need to be solved to implement the operation of the application:
a) how to identify the current use scene of the television;
b) how to monitor the user's keystrokes;
c) how to achieve normal operation of the application.
For how to identify the current user usage scenario, a class is first introduced: the accessitivyservice, which operates in the background, may monitor some state changes of the user interface, such as page switching, focus change, notification, Toast, key-press, etc. The judgment of the current scene can be realized by inheriting the service. The scene judgment is divided into two steps:
the first step is as follows: determine what application is currently: after inheriting the accessitiveService, the method is triggered by self-defining the onassitiveEvent () method when the application interface changes. In the method, the currently used application and the top-level Activity are judged in real time through an Android standard ActivityManager;
the second step is that: judging the current scene of the application: and acquiring the text information of all controls under the current application scene through the Access availability service, getWindows (), and judging the current specific scene by searching key text information.
And by combining the information, the specific use scene of the current specific application can be judged through the package name, TopAactivity and the key character information of the current application.
How to monitor the user key is also the same as the type using accessitivyservice, all the user keys are firstly called back to the accessitivyservice.
How to realize the normal operation of the application needs to be judged by combining the current scene and the operation keys. There are roughly three general methods currently being worked out.
1) Holding the key: operating according to the original key logic
2) Key conversion: the original left and right keys or the fixed key are converted into other key values and then sent out.
3) Auxiliary operation popup: on the premise that the keys cannot meet all operation behaviors, one key is converted into two or more operation functions. The specific method is that after the key is pressed, a popup window with a plurality of operation function options is popped up, and then a specific operation target is selected.
Example 2
A method for realizing the control application of an intelligent television controller comprises the following steps:
step1 the wireless network page is launched and the page interaction toggles the option up and down.
And Step2, the self-defined onAccessivelyEvent method monitors the page change and identifies that the current scene is a wireless network interface.
Step3, the key is rotated left and right at the moment, the onKeyEvent method is triggered, and the left/right key is judged to be converted into an up/down key according to the identified scene; at the moment, the received left/right key is converted into an up/down key and then sent out; operation of the wireless network is now enabled.
And Step4, after the video playing page is started, the current video playing page is monitored through the same method as the Step 2.
Step5, at this time, the key is rotated left and right, the onKeyEvent method is triggered, and the video application can realize the function of fast forwarding/fast rewinding after receiving the left and right keys by combining the identified scenes and judging that no processing is needed to be performed on the key.
Step6, when the knob is clicked, the video application is paused under normal conditions, but the user can not exit from the video playing because the television has no return key, therefore, when the knob is clicked, the button is kept to pause the video, an auxiliary operation popup window for confirming exit and continuous playing is popped up, and the user can click one of the auxiliary operation popup windows to select exit from the playing or continuous playing, thereby solving the problem that the user can not exit from the playing interface without the return key.
